HS: asyncError — rejected promise triggers catch block (+1 test)
Three-part fix for hs-upstream-core/asyncError test 2/2:

1. runtime.sx hs-win-call: when an async call returns a rejected promise,
   store the error value in window.__hs_async_error (side-channel) and
   raise the sentinel "__hs_async_error__" so the value survives the
   raise boundary intact.

2. compiler.sx catch clause: inject `(let ((var (host-hs-normalize-exc var))) ...)`
   around the catch body so the sentinel gets swapped for the real error
   object before user code runs. Uses let (not set!) so shadowing works
   correctly for guard catch variables.

3. tests/hs-run-filtered.js:
   - host-promise-state wraps JS Error objects as plain {message:...} dicts
     before they cross the WASM boundary (Error.toString() was producing
     "Error: boom" strings instead of accessible objects)
   - host-hs-normalize-exc native retrieves the side-channel value when
     the sentinel arrives in a catch variable
   - host-get coercion restricted to El instances — plain JS objects with
     a "value" key were being stringified to "[object Object]"
